Rippling

rippling pricing

Rippling charges companies on a monthly subscription basis. Rippling is a premium priced solution compared to their peers, often charging $21-29 PEPM for the Core HR features and another $5-20 PEPM for their IT management features.

In addition to the software fees, implementing Rippling will require a one-time implementation fee. Rippling will charge ~ 5-15% of the annual software fees for their implementation fees (i.e., $5-15K implementation fee on a $100K annual purchase)

What Modules Are Included with Rippling HR Pricing?
HRIS & Employee Management

Rippling's Core HR platform, called Unity. Rippling Unity is their global HRIS offering that services as a single source of truth for all employee data. Providing a single HR software platform for all employee needs helps to drive employee engagement because users can take control of their data and take actions on their own, such as requesting time off or updating their demographic data.
Atop this database of employee information, Rippling has built a set of enterprise analytics, workflows, approvals, and permissions. This provides unparalleled automation as the rules control how the data syncs between all of the modules.

Rippling Payroll

Payroll is at key component of Rippling's employee management system. Rippling has been designed from its founding to be deeply integrated across all modules, so when you update benefits or request PTO, the new deductions and PTO sync to Rippling’s payroll module automatically.

Rippling's payroll services include all of the expected payroll management features, such as: unlimited payroll processing, filing of payroll taxes, integrations with time tracking tools, PTO balances and 401K providers and deductions from benefit platforms.

Rippling's payroll software streamlines the payroll process for small businesses, in part, due to their unique single database architecture which ensures that data in the employee management platform is constantly in sync.

Benefits Administration

Rippling offers a built-in Benefits Administration module. The Benefits Administration module allows users to enroll in employee benefits during open enrollment and onboarding. Rippling support most health insurance carrier feeds and gives users access to HSAs (health savings accounts), FSAs (flex spending accounts) and commuter benefits.

Rippling's benefits administration platform feeds right into Rippling payroll and automatically deducts a user's employee benefits from their payroll. Rippling is broker agnostic, but can also serve as a health insurance broker, if a company needs those services.

Employee Onboarding

Rippling offers a cutting edge approach to new hire onboarding. Employee data is collected or imported from the applicant tracking system and is immediately converted into the employee management system. Rippling has a built-in e-signature tool that allows for easy, time-saving completion of all onboarding paperwork and also allows for the collection of custom data during onboarding as well.

IT & Device Management

While most systems can collect new hire paper work - such as W4s and I-9s, the Rippling system goes a step further by also supporting device management. This is a unique feature from Rippling and something that is really only seen in single sign on platforms, like Okta.

This device management feature allows the new hire onboarding process to include the process of ordering new computers for employees, having those shipped to an employee's address and it allows for full-service app management. App management allows the auto-provisioning of all business applications (email, Salesforce, Jira, etc.) for new hires based on the underlying employee attributes: department, work location, team, etc.

Time and Attendance tracking

Rippling also offers a full suite of time & attendance tracking tools. Having Rippling's time tracking tools built right into payroll management allows small businesses to process payroll without having to track down hours worked, shifts missed and overtime. They are planning on launching their own scheduling functionality by the end of 2024.

Who is Rippling?

Rippling was founded in 2016 by Parker Conrad, the former founder and CEO of Zenefits. Zenefits was once the hottest platform in the HRIS industry before a sequence of scandals, which led to Parker Conrad leaving the company.

Many of the Zenefits lessons learned have been put into practice at Rippling, as they've continued to build sleek, integration-centric technology for small and medium-sized businesses.

Rippling is now one of the fastest growing and most valuable private companies in the HRIS space and is developing new modules and capabilities quicker than almost any other competitor.

What Sized Companies Fit Rippling Best?

Rippling an SMB HRIS, which means the system works best for companies with less than 350 employees. SMB solutions are designed to cover some, but not all HR needs with some gaps to be filled in by 3rd party solutions. SMB solutions are typically more user-friendly and more modernly designed than other vendors. Additionally, they are typically built with integrations in mind and have open APIs.

SMB solutions typically take about 6-12 weeks to implement and often do not require a great deal of work from an administrator to get started, due to the fact that most of the system is not configurable. SMB solutions tend to have limited rules engines and custom workflow tools, which can limit how scalable they can be.

Pros and Cons of Rippling
Rippling's Strengths:
  • Rippling gets the highest reviews in the HRIS space for their modern user experience
  • Rippling’s most differentiated offering is their onboarding modules which syncs all of IT and HR tasks seamlessly into the process and includes an app management feature
  • This is especially relevant for white collar workforces that have numerous workflow and productivity apps that employees use
  • Rippling is one of the best in the business at integrating with 3rd party software
  • They have a pre-built integration with dozens of hundreds of 3rd party HR platforms, including Greenhouse, Lever, Carta and Pave
  • Rippling offers a dynamic workflow builder tool which helps companies create automated actions and triggers using 3rd party data
  • Rippling has ambitiously moved into the global HR space, offering deep in-country localization, global payroll & EOR - all built into a single system
  • Rippling recently made their payroll & benefits admin modules optional, giving organizations more flexibility to use their preferred in-country payroll vendors
Concerns with Rippling:
  • Rippling is still very much a start-up and the feedback from many customers is that the system isn’t as ironed out and automated as it may appear in demos
  • This could apply to some of Rippling’s newer modules like performance
  • Rippling offers a native time & attendance solution, but it may not be viable for businesses with complex workforce management needs 
  • Rippling is the most recently founded company on the list and is still highly concentrated in the small business segment, so the system’s scalability is a question
  • The majority of their customers have below 200 employees
  • Rippling’s founding team came from Zenefits, which had a tumultuous history, so that is something to explore and get comfortable with
  • Rippling’s customer support model is primarily chat-based and they only recently added a phone option, which is only available to clients with 150+ EEs
